Bapu Nagar, Jaipur Property Price Trends and Appreciation
Property rates in Bapu Nagar have seen a slight adjustment, with current values at ₹8,100 per sq ft compared to ₹8,800 per sq ft in the previous quarter. This movement reflects the dynamic nature of the local real estate landscape. Meanwhile, the broader micromarket rate has also adjusted to ₹7,400 per sq ft from its previous mark of ₹8,050 per sq ft.
Bapu Nagar maintains a distinct premium over surrounding areas, reflecting its central position in Jaipur. Nearby Tonk Road averages ₹5,400 per sq ft, while Civil Lines hovers around ₹5,500 per sq ft. These figures highlight the value premium that Bapu Nagar commands, often exceeding neighboring localities by a significant margin due to its established infrastructure.
The residential market in Bapu Nagar is primarily defined by its apartment offerings, which are currently priced at an average of ₹8,100 per sq ft. This segment has experienced a change of -7.72%, presenting potential entry opportunities for buyers looking to invest in a prime city location. Rental Trends
Rental Trends and Average Rent in Bapu Nagar, Jaipur
Rental demand in Bapu Nagar is segmented by unit size, with 1 BHK apartments averaging ₹10,900 per month. Those seeking more space can opt for 2 BHK units at ₹15,650 per month, while 3 BHK units command a premium average of ₹29,750 per month. Rental rates across the region vary, with Raja Park, C Scheme, and Sodala all averaging ₹50 per sq ft. Meanwhile, Shyam Nagar and Modi Nagar have seen rental rate adjustments of -10% and -8% respectively, reflecting localized shifts in tenant demand. Apartments in Bapu Nagar remain the preferred choice for tenants, with an average rental rate of ₹50 per sq ft. This segment has shown consistent performance with a 3.7% increase in rental values over the past year. Top projects such as SDC Royale and Pearl Oasis offer premium rental options in the locality.
